Early discovery is central to Pfizer’s research engine, driving projects across Internal Medicine, Inflammation & Immunology, Vaccines, and Oncology. In the first installment of “The Mindfulness of Medicine Development,” we spotlight Jaimeen, a chemical biologist on the frontlines of drug discovery, as he shares his role in the early stages of developing potential new medicines to help treat challenging diseases.

Jaimeen's fascination with the power of chemistry and biology was sparked at a young age, marveling at the differences a single neutron or electron could make in the properties of elements or pondering why certain herbs were thought to alleviate common cold symptoms. This curiosity about the fundamental building blocks of life led him to pursue a career in scientific research, driven by a desire to expand the boundaries of human knowledge and, ultimately, improve patient outcomes.

At Pfizer, Jaimeen and his team work to unravel the complexities of disease-causing proteins, seeking to understand their intricate webs of interactions and identify small molecules that can disrupt their harmful activities. As he explains, "It's really becoming a detective, being a sleuth, bringing all the tools of the trade, bringing in colleagues with different backgrounds, diversity of thought, all of that pours in."

This collaborative and cross-functional approach fuels Jaimeen's passion for his work. He finds inspiration in the shared commitment to helping patients, even at the earliest discovery stages, by pushing the boundaries of scientific understanding.

"It's really the uncertainty and the excitement of what new thing will I learn today? What will I know that I didn't know yesterday?" he says.
